The Senior Analyst, Lease Accounting involves reviewing and interpreting lease documents to ensure accurate setup for billing tenants and verifying the accuracy of tenant recoveries during key processes such as month end, final billings and the annual budget process. The role will be part of a high-reaching team that values people development and long-term growth, and will be responsible for tasks such as completing recovery calculations, assisting various teams with lease setups, and providing financial analysis. You will be responsible for: Review and Interpretation of Lease Documents Track all leasing activity for assigned portfolio Review and interpret lease documents to ensure accurate tenant billings Ensure accurate lease setup in the accounting system Assist property management teams in investigating and responding to tenant queries or disputes Maintain Recovery Calculations Ensuring accuracy of recoveries during month end, final billing and the annual budget process Completing recovery calculations within the Common Area Maintenance (CAM), utility and property tax models Post monthly recovery accrual Identifying, recommending, and implementing process and system improvements Setting up tenant recovery models for new properties as required Support of Business Partners Providing accounting with variance commentary Assist asset management, legal and leasing teams, ensuring deals are drafted to maximize recoveries Providing financial analysis to determine the impacts of selected exception deals and recovery ratios Assist property managers in analyzing leasing impacts on rates Required Skills and Experience Lease abstraction and contract management - Review and interpret complex lease agreements, amendments, renewals and translate terms into billing and recovery processes. Stakeholder Management and Influencing Skills - Collaborate with internal stakeholders building relationships, explaining financial impacts, resolving disputes for positive outcomes Process improvement and Systems Optimization - Analyze inefficiencies to enhance CAM/Recovery models, improve control and optimize how data moves through internal systems Preferred Skills and Experience University degree 5 years of experience in reading and interpreting leases, preferably for commercial tenants Have an understanding of accounting concepts as it relates to the real estate industry Highly proficient in Microsoft Excel and have strong financial analytical and problem-solving skills Detail oriented and focused on accuracy Excellent communicator in both written and verbal form Embrace collaborative sharing of knowledge within a teamwork environment Thrive in organizations that constantly evolve and can work well under pressure Are driven to achieve results and strive to deliver high performance through creative thinking Have experience working with large ERP systems, preferably JD Edwards/Yardi This posting is for an existing vacancy. The expected salary range for this position is $72,000.00 - $108,000.00 per year.
